Quote:
"At the behest of a number of Greeks, I recently contacted the Library of Congress about the "secret ritual" issue. When I got through to general information they routed me to the reading room, where a kind lady cut me off before I could even finish my question, "...I already know what you're going to ask. It's not true. It's just a myth. We get this a lot." She kindly agreed to send me a form letter that they send to everyone who writes in (or comes in) wanting to know where they can find all the fraternity rituals (except theirs of course). What they sent me was a very politely worded response indicating that they don't have secret college rituals in their collection" ....you can see it here: http://sac.uky.edu/~elrous0/loc-off.htm and also the "scanned in" letter is here: http://sac.uky.edu/~elrous0/loc.gif Enjoy! http://www.greekchat.com/forums/ubb/biggrin.gif |
